Use of Cookies
The Sites use "cookies" to help us recognize you and to personalize your online
experience. A cookie is a text file that is placed on your hard disk by a Web
page server. Cookies cannot be used to run programs or deliver viruses to your
computer. Cookies are uniquely assigned to your computer, and can only be read
by a web server in the domain that issued the cookie to you.
One of the primary purposes of cookies is to provide a convenience feature to
save you time. The purpose of a cookie is to tell the Web server that you have
returned to a specific page. For example, if you personalize a page on one or
more of our Sites, or register with FanGap, a cookie helps us to recall your
specific information on subsequent visits. This simplifies the process of
recording your personal information, such as your name, billing addresses,
shipping addresses, and so on. When you return to the same FanGap Site, the
information you previously provided can be retrieved, so you can easily use the
features that you customized.
You have the ability to accept or decline cookies. Most Web browsers
automatically accept cookies, but you can usually modify your browser setting to
decline cookies if you prefer. If you choose to decline cookies, you may not be
able to fully experience the interactive features of the Sites you visit.
